## PickPath Optimizer: restart procedure

If the PickPath optimizer stalls mid-batch, drain the queue before restarting; partial pick lists corrupt the Larkmoor warehouse zone weights. After draining, verify the solver heartbeat resumes within two minutes. Restarting without draining requires a full zone-weight rebuild, which takes roughly an hour. Before any restart, confirm the running instance matches the expected settings, which are shown here.

config for kafof-bawef:
holath:
  log_level: debug
  metrics_host: metrics.holath.qorvelsys.internal
  pin: 2191
  pool_size: 32

Management Meeting Minutes — Reseller Programme

Present: Dena Forsgate, Ollie Rennick, Priya Calloway.

Quick recap: the Fernlight reseller programme is tracking ahead of plan — 14 partners signed versus the 10 we'd hoped for. Margins are a bit thinner than modelled, mostly down to the tiered discount we offered early joiners. Ollie will tighten the discount bands before the next intake. Where we want to take the programme next is covered in the note below.

board note of yahip-tadug: Headcount on the Zorath team goes from 9 to 100 by the end of April. Gross margin on Zorath came in at 10 percent against a plan of 20 percent.

Sweepline runs nightly and deletes records past their retention class. Plugins declare a retention class per table in their manifest; undeclared tables default to 30 days. Hard rules: never write to a table mid-sweep (acquire the sweep lock first), and don't assume deletes are immediate — tombstones persist for 48 hours. Test against the staging sweeper before shipping; production exemptions require review. Manifest schema and lock API docs are in the developer portal. Questions about retention classes or exemptions go here.

alerts address for kajef-hadug: istys@zemvarnet.local

Handover note — Harrowfield telemetry gateway

From Pell to Janric, for the weekly sync: the gateway collecting tractor and combine telemetry is stable after the MQTT buffer fix. Remaining items: firmware rollout to the Millbrae fleet and retiring the legacy CSV exporter. Credentials for the field-provisioning vault rotate Friday; the vault is currently sealed. To unseal it during handover, use the recovery passphrase below.

vault phrase of kafog-kahif = holdor-rusir-praox